The Breakdown 5

  • Billionaire Mark Cuban, celebrated for his role as the former owner of the Dallas Mavericks, is leading a new venture with Harbinger Sports Partners, which has just acquired a minority stake in the Oakland Athletics.
  • This strategic investment aligns with the Athletics' ambitious plans to relocate to Las Vegas in 2028, signaling a new chapter for the franchise.
  • While the exact percentage of ownership purchased by Cuban's group remains undisclosed, the acquisition marks a significant entry into Major League Baseball for the investor.
  • The move reflects a growing trend of high-profile investors entering sports ownership, particularly as teams explore new markets and opportunities for expansion.
  • Current owner John Fisher is noted as the seller of the stake, underscoring the ongoing transformation within the Athletics organization.
  • As the team gears up for a relocation, this investment could bring fresh enthusiasm and resources to the franchise amid its transition to a vibrant new home.

Who is John Fisher and his role in the A's?

John Fisher is the principal owner of the Oakland Athletics, having acquired the team in 2005. He is a prominent businessman and investor, involved in various ventures, including retail and real estate. Fisher's leadership has been marked by a focus on cost management, which has drawn criticism from fans who feel the team has not invested enough in player development and acquisitions. His decision to sell a minority stake to Cuban reflects a strategic shift as the team prepares for relocation.

How has Las Vegas become a sports hub?

Las Vegas has rapidly evolved into a sports hub due to its growing population, tourism, and entertainment infrastructure. The successful establishment of professional franchises such as the NHL's Golden Knights and the NFL's Raiders has demonstrated the city's capacity to support major sports teams. This trend is further bolstered by investments in sports facilities and a culture that embraces entertainment, making it an attractive destination for both teams and fans.
